Same rules apply here as they do oregano: Use a 1:1 swap of fresh marjoram for fresh thyme; a 1:1 swap of dried marjoram for dried thyme; half the amount of dried marjoram as a swap for fresh thyme, and twice the amount of fresh marjoram for dried thyme. Nowadays, though you might see thyme in the ingredients lists of some of your favorite hygiene and beauty products (that's thanks to thymol, a naturally-occurring chemical found in thyme oil, that has antimicrobial and antifungal properties), it's more likely that you'll see it in recipes for roast chicken, turkey, or stuffing, or as an ingredient in any number of dried poultry spice blends. But if you're swapping dried oregano for fresh thyme, you'll want to use half the amount of dried oregano for the amount of fresh thyme called for, as the dried herb can be potent and throw your recipe off balance.
